How are Transition Metal Carbides and Nitrides Synthesized?

There are several methods for synthesizing these materials, including:
Direct reaction of the metal with carbon or nitrogen at high temperatures.
Carbothermal or nitridothermal reduction, where metal oxides are reduced in the presence of carbon or nitrogen-containing gases.
Sol-gel and chemical vapor deposition methods, which allow for more controlled synthesis at lower temperatures.
The choice of synthesis method can significantly influence the properties and catalytic performance of the resulting materials.
